In addition to the Edge and Vibe, Disney Wish has a third venue called The Hideaway. It's located adjacent to Vibe and has a flex wall that can be opened to create a larger teen space, closed off for preteen events, and even reserved for guests 18 to 20 during special events. On Disney Fantasy and Disney Dream, the space at Vibe also features a private outdoor deck with chaise lounges, wading pools, foosball and more. While indoors, teenagers can order sodas and smoothies from the fountain bar, mingle with others their age, or just kick back and relax in individual nooks. There’s a dance club area for karaoke contests, talent shows and dance competitions. The trendy indoor/outdoor space — at almost 9,000 square feet — is accessible with a “teen-only” card. On the new Disney Wish ship, Vibe has a French twist inspired by a French artists loft with neon signs and funk pop art. If you’re sailing on the Adventures by Disney Rhine River Cruise itinerary, for example — and docked in Strasbourg, France, for the day — guests can choose between various exciting excursions. Teen-friendly options include a tour of the Black Forest, complete with a toboggan run and a visit to a woodworking museum, or zip lining through the Black Forest combined with a hike to the Triberg Waterfalls. In Melk, Austria, on the Danube itinerary, families can go for a bike ride along the Danube River, hike to the castle in Dürnstein or visit a family-run apricot farm. Another great feature of these cruises is that teens can opt to have dinner and evening get-togethers with same-age cruisers, so they don’t have to dine with their parents or younger siblings every night. Adventure Guides also curate special activities for teens like game shows and pool parties. One highlight of NCL’s cruise overview is their dedicated teen clubs, exclusive spaces designed for teenagers to socialize and have fun onboard. These clubs offer a safe environment where teens can meet new friends while participating in various activities tailored specifically for them. From dance parties and karaoke nights to video game tournaments and movie screenings, there is never a dull moment at the teen clubs.
